Use courteous in a sentence - Example Sentences for courteous

Her children are generally very courteous, and will undoubtedly be very well-behaved.

So characteristic of what a pious Christian would say, this courteous phrase.

Whenever you disagree with me, I hope you will be honest and courteous enough to let me know.

The people of Madagascar are extremely courteous, and generally will not speak too loudly.

Francis Bacon wrote that if a man be gracious and courteous to strangers, it shows he is a citizen of the world, and that his heart is no island cut off from others' lands, but a continent that joins to them.

We promise prompt courteous service, and the best prices in town.

The children have to learn that it is courteous to thank people for a gift, even when it is something they don't want.

It is very courteous of you to call on me.
